Heartbeat Sensor Module KY-039 by Finger
Operating Voltage: 3.3V to 5V DC
Operating Temperature Range: -40°C to 85°C
Dimensions: Approximately 19mm x 15mm
Output Type: Analog voltage signal
Interface: 3-pin header (VCC, GND, Signal)
Pin Configuration
VCC: Connect to 3.3V or 5V power supply
GND: Connect to ground
Signal (S): Analog output to be connected to an analog input pin on the microcontroller
Analog Output: Provides a continuous analog voltage corresponding to the heartbeat signal.
Infrared Sensing: Employs an IR LED and phototransistor to detect variations in light intensity caused by blood flow.
Compact Design: Small form factor (approximately 19mm x 15mm) suitable for wearable and portable applications.
Low Power Consumption: Operates efficiently within a voltage range of 3.3V to 5V.
Usage Tips :
Finger Placement: Ensure the finger is properly positioned between the IR LED and phototransistor for accurate readings.
Ambient Light: Minimize exposure to ambient light to reduce interference. Consider enclosing the sensor or using it in a controlled lighting environment.
Signal Processing: Implement filtering techniques in software to smooth out the analog signal and accurately detect heartbeats.
